随着数字货币和区块链技术的迅猛发展,安全性成为越来越多用户关注的焦点。在这种背景下,多重签名技术应运而生。所谓多重签名,是指一笔交易需要多个私钥的签名才能生效,这种机制极大地提高了数字资产的安全性。本文将详细探讨多重签名的作用、应用场景、以及其面临的挑战,并提供相关问题的详尽解答。
## 多重签名的基本原理多重签名(Multisignature或Multisig)是一种需要多个密钥进行交易授权的机制。它适用于加密货币和区块链的应用中,当交易发起时,必须由多个密钥持有者共同签署,才能完成交易。这相当于设定多重检查机制,确保交易的安全性。
多重签名通常会指定一个阈值,比如“2中的3”,意味着在三个持有者中,至少需要两个签名才能执行交易。每个持有者生成自己的密钥对,其中公钥被上传至区块链,而私钥则由持有者自己保管。只有在达到设定的签名数量时,交易才会被执行。
## 多重签名的主要功能多重签名最显著的特点是其能够显著提升安全性。通过要求多个签名,降低了个别私钥被盗用或遗失的风险。例如,如果一个用户的私钥遭到黑客攻击,资产仍然安全,因为其他密钥未被非法获取。
多重签名能够有效防止各种欺诈行为。商家和消费者在交易时,可以采用多重签名机制,让双方的权益得到更好的保障。即便有一方想要恶意交易,另一方也可以通过不同的签名角色来维护自己的权益。
对企业或团体来说,多重签名提供了一种优雅的资产管理方式。组织内多个决策者可共同管理资金,从而避免单一决定可能带来的损失。这种透明的决策机制有助于提升组织的信任度和透明度。
## 多重签名的应用场景在加密货币交易中,多重签名被广泛应用。例如,许多数字货币钱包支持多重签名功能,以保证用户资产的安全。用户可以设定多个授权签名者,确保无论是谁想要转移资金,都会受到其他授权人的监督。
对于企业来说,多重签名是一种有效的资金管理工具。企业可以设定多个财务管理者来共同审核支付请求,从而减少错误支付和内部舞弊的风险。许多初创企业也开始在资金管理中应用多重签名,确保资金使用透明。
智能合约允许各种条件和条款在区块链上自动执行,而多重签名能为这些合约增加额外的安全层。例如,合约代码可以规定在执行时需要多个签名,确保合同执行的合规性。
## 多重签名的优势与挑战多重签名的优势显而易见,它能够有效减少黑客攻击、欺诈以及内部舞弊的风险。同时,它可以提升透明度,使得所有参与者都能看到交易历史,增加交易的信任度。此外,多重签名也适用于多方管理,使决策过程更加民主。
尽管多重签名具有诸多优势,但也面临一些挑战,包括技术复杂性和管理的困难。对于不熟悉区块链技术的用户而言,设置和管理多重签名可能显得难以操作。另外,多个持有者之间的沟通协调也是一个重要的挑战,任何一个签名者的缺席都有可能导致交易的延迟或失败。
## 如何设置多重签名为了设置多重签名,用户首先需要选择适合的多重签名钱包。目前市面上有许多提供多重签名服务的钱包,用户需要根据自己的需求选定合适的产品,如选择支持多种加密货币的钱包,或者支持合约功能的钱包。
设置多重签名钱包的过程一般包括生成密钥对、上传公钥、设定签名阈值和添加授权人。用户需要根据具体钱包的指导,按照步骤进行操作。确保每个签署者的私钥安全存储,并定期备份。此外,用户还需关注交易费用,以选择最佳时间进行交易。
## 未来展望随着区块链技术的不断发展,多重签名技术也将持续演进。例如,随着智能合约的普及和3D安全认证的引入,多重签名将会变得更加智能化和灵活,进一步提高交易的安全性和效率。
多重签名技术的普及将大大提高数字资产管理的安全性和透明度,有助于吸引更多用户参与加密市场。随着更多企业和个人认识到其重要性,必将推动数字资产管理模式的转变,安全风险将大幅降低。
## 相关问题解答 ### 常见问题与解答 1. **多重签名和普通签名的区别是什么?** - 多重签名需要多个密钥的共同签名,提供更高的安全性,相对而言,普通签名仅需单一密钥即可完成交易。 2. **如果我失去了一个签名者的私钥怎么办?** - 这将视具体的签名阈值而定。如果你的设定是“2中的3”,那么即使失去一个私钥,你依然可以完成交易。 3. **多重签名会增加交易延迟吗?** - 是的,由于需要多个授权者的批准,交易通常会比普通签名交易稍慢,但换来的是更高的安全性。 4. **除了加密货币,还有哪些领域可以使用多重签名?** - 多重签名可用于金融机构、法律合约甚至投票系统中,目的均是提高信任度和安全性。 5. **多重签名是否可以被破解?** - 虽然多重签名增强了安全性,但没有绝对安全的措施。黑客依然可能通过其他手段攻击,例如社会工程学。 6. **我可以在一个钱包里使用多重签名吗?** - 许多现代数字货币钱包支持多重签名功能,用户可以设置多个签名者。 以上即为多重签名的作用及其相关问题的详尽解答。希望本文能够帮助你更好地理解多重签名的价值,以及怎样在实际生活中运用这一技术来保护你的数字资产。